Two killed, 4 others injured in Assam violence

Kokrajhar: In stray poll-related
incidents in Assam, which goes for second phase assembly
polls on Monday, two persons have been killed and three
mediapersons injured in Kokrajhar while the personal security
officer of a candidate was injured in Kamrup (rural)
districts.

Two supporters of minority-dominated All India
United Democratic Front (AIUDF) Giasuddin Sheikh and
Joyamuddin Sheikh were killed yesterday as they were hit by
missiles from a rampaging mob after AIUDF President Badaruddin
Ajmal failed to address a scheduled election rally, the police
said.

Ajmal could not arrive as his helicopter failed to
land due to a technical snag.

The correspondent of English daily `The Sentinel` and
two others of a local satellite channel were injured in stone
pelting. They have been admitted to a local hospital for
treatment.

Kokrajhar district is the headquarters of Bodoland
Territorial Council (BTC), run by the Bodoland People`s Party
(BPF), an ally of the ruling Congress which is pitted against
AIUDF.

In another poll-related incident today the personal
security officer of Congress candidate, former MP Kirip
Chaliha, was injured after he was hit on the head by a
stone hurled by supporters of the rival TC candidate at Hajo
in Kamrup (rural) district.

Police said Chaliha had entered the house of a party
activist when TC supporters blocked the area alleging that he
had gone to distribute money.

The TC activists shouted slogans and hurled stones in
which the security officer was injured and his car`s window
panes smashed.

Kamrup (rural) district Superintendent of Police
Apurba Jibon Baruah said the situation was brought under
control and Chaliha has been escorted back.

Baruah said 26 companies of additional forces have
been deployed in the district including those from the Tripura
Reserve Police Force, BSF and CRPF.

The Kokrajhar Press Club has condemned the attack on
media and demanded proper security for the media for
Monday`s poll.
